The War Memorial Gardens in Kirkcaldy provide a touching tribute to those who fought and died in the World Wars. The gardens are well kept and whenever I have walked through them, people are always enjoying a troll through me to escape the noisy high street.
However, it is when you get to the Memorial that you are struck by your surroundings. It is the amount of names on the walls of those who have fallen in both world wars that shocks you. Hundreds of names are listed, all local men, who died for their country. The monument is a fitting tribute to a sacrifice that should never be forgotten.
